Serie A champions, Napoli, has finally spoken about a TikTok video it posted on their official page which has been generating reactions in Italy and across the world.
The clip appears to mock the 24-year-old Nigeria international for missing a penalty during their 0-0 draw with Bologna in Serie A last weekend.
Meanwhile, Napoli, in a statement, on Thursday said “To avoid any potential exploitation of the matter, SSC Napoli would like to explicitly state that the club never intended to offend or make fun of Victor Osimhen, who is an asset to the club.”
The club further stated that its firm decision to reject all offers for the Nigerian striker in the striker showed its appreciation for the striker.
“Over the course of the summer, Napoli rejected all offers to sign the striker – firm proof of the club’s appreciation of him.
“On social media and TikTok particularly, expressive language is used in a light-hearted and playful manner. In this case involving Victor, there was no intention of mockery or derision.”
